Jang Na-ra (Korean: 장나라; born March 18, 1981) is a South Korean singer and actress active in both the South Korean and Chinese entertainment industries since 2001. She rose to prominence with her hit studio album Sweet Dream in 2002, and starred in well-received television series Successful Story of a Bright Girl (2002), My Love Patzzi (2002), Wedding (2005), My Bratty Princess (2005), Confession Couple (2017), The Last Empress (2018–2019), and VIP (2019).
